Pfizer Inc. / Vicuron Pharmaceuticals Inc.

2004 · Acquisition/Merger · $1.9B · Complete

WRONG BY 53 POINTS

Pfizer expensed $1.4B upfront, then gave away half the pipeline for $10M three years later — a textbook value-destroying anti-infectives bet

Announced mid-June 2004; $29.10/share cash; anti-infectives anidulafungin, dalbavancin; closed Sep 14 2005

Did it work? Outcome assessment

Pfizer expensed $1.4B upfront, then gave away half the pipeline for $10M three years later — a textbook value-destroying anti-infectives bet
